Dean for Model Number cde7000w When I try to start my dryer it will not start. When I push in the start button nothing happens.
Answer Dean, there are other comopnents to check before you replace the timer. First, make sure you have 240 VAC at the rear terminal block on the back of the dryer. Raise the top( press in on the spring clips and lift up on the corner) and check the door switch circuit LA-1005, with the door closed there should be a "closed " circuit between the terminals and an "open" circuit with the door open. From there, check the hi limit and thermal fuse, located on the heater housing in the top left rear corner of the cabinet LA-1053 if either of these check with an open circuit, you will need to replace these parts.
